Dallas – the modern heart of Texas
Dallas is one of the most distinctive cities in Texas – modern, dynamic and full of contrasts. On one side you’ll find futuristic skyscrapers and vibrant business districts, while on the other there are places deeply connected to American history.
During our visit Dallas surprised us more than once. We explored beautiful botanical gardens along White Rock Lake, encountered exotic wildlife at the Dallas World Aquarium and visited sites connected to one of the most significant events in American history.
Top Places
Dallas Arboretum
One of the most beautiful botanical gardens in the USA located on White Rock Lake.
Dallas World Aquarium
A unique combination of aquarium, jungle and zoo right in the city center.
Sixth Floor Museum
A museum dedicated to the history of the assassination of President John F. Kennedy.
Dealey Plaza
One of the most historic places in Dallas.
Dallas Museum of Art
Extremely rich collections from all over the world.
